BO coded radiators were the standard,used on all M/T 1969 & 1970 L-78 equipped chevelles.
It's the standard 5.2Qt.,3 row radiator for them,not the Heavy duty 4 row.
That std. radiator used a 4 row passenger side tank,but the drivers side IA tank was a 3 row,used on all M/T & Auto Trans Chevelles.
Both of these years/models also used the #165 fan shroud too.
When HD cooling~5.9Qt. was ordered on a BB 1969/70 L-78 Chevelle,the factory swapped out the Chevelles drivers IA tank for a wider 4 row tank turning it into either a PA~M/T or PD~A/T coded radiator.Also shaving down the extended fan shroud lip,both on the drivers side and bottom of the #165 shroud,to now accommodate the 4th row.
